Trillium Staffing is looking for a hands-on Fabrication Associate I to join a local manufacturing team. In this direct hire role, you’ll work with blueprints, operate fabrication equipment, and help produce high-quality metal components. This is a great opportunity for someone with fabrication experience who enjoys working in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
1st shift - M-F 8:00 am - 4:30 pm
$21-$24 per hour DOE

What You’ll Do:
-Read and interpret blueprints and engineering drawings
-Plan and execute fabrication processes, including cutting, bending, and welding
-Set up and operate fabrication equipment and machinery
-Perform MIG, TIG, and stick welding on various metal components
-Inspect finished parts to ensure they meet quality standards
-Troubleshoot minor equipment issues and suggest process improvements
-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work area
-Follow all safety guidelines and properly use required PPE

Qualifications:
-1–3 years of experience in metal fabrication or a related field
-Associate degree (or equivalent experience) in a related field preferred
-Strong understanding of fabrication methods, tools, and materials
-Ability to read blueprints and perform shop math
-Experience with welding (MIG/TIG/Stick)
-Familiarity with manufacturing processes and lean principles is a plus
-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ality
-Ability to pass pre-employment screenings
